Agile software engineers, developers and testers become trusted business partners by driving business innovation and growth. Application technical professionals must embrace continuous learning, adopt DevOps practices and adapt to new ways of working to improve business and customer outcomes.
To accelerate development and enable continuous delivery of customer value, organizations need to reach the next level in their agile and DevOps practices. Application leaders must focus on value stream management to maximize flow, improve delivery efficiency and drive innovation.
Application technical professionals should:
- Create a personal development plan to identify and develop the core skills, such as cloud, automation, DevOps and AI/ML, needed to remain competitive
- Adopt DevOps practices and architect applications to leverage the benefits of low-code, cloud platforms, multigrained services and extreme automation; go beyond Scrum or Kanban by developing proficiency with the technical practices required to deliver working software frequently
- Work together with your business partners to visualize and optimize the flow of value from customer request to production deployment; proactively engaging your business partners creates transparency and fosters the openness that increases business knowledge while building trust
- Create remote working agreements that protect work-life balance and social connections of the team; establish core working hours, define expected behaviors, agree on virtual collaboration approaches, and adopt tools that facilitate agile processes and events
Want to dig deeper? Explore how application technical professionals can plan and develop DevOps and Agile software in this research note while we build the agenda for the virtual Gartner Application Innovation & Business Solutions Summit 2021.